The Boks' director said the Irish No 10 had an 'aura' and was a 'very intimidating' figure for the defending champions.
“He is vital in my opinion. When I was at Munster, we beat them once. Whenever Johnny is in the team a lot of things happen, not just as a player. I think the aura around him and his presence ,” said Erasmus.“For a man at 38 to score tries like he did this weekend . As long as he is physically out there, there is no doubt about .
Their two massive wins over Romania and Tonga sees them on top of pool B and a win over the Boks will secure their place in the quarterfinals ahead of their final pool match against Scotland.
